When evaluating online form builders for Shopify stores, it's essential to consider tools that integrate seamlessly with Shopify's ecosystem and offer features tailored to e-commerce needs. Tally, Typeform, and Fillout are three such platforms that frequently come up in discussions.
Tally
Tally is a free, minimalistic form builder inspired by Notion's interface, allowing users to create forms with a clean, block-based editor. It offers unlimited forms and responses on its free tier, making it an attractive option for those seeking simplicity without financial commitment.
Features:
- Unlimited forms and responses on the free plan.
- Multi-page forms and column layouts.
- Customizable design elements, including fonts, colors, and backgrounds.
- Embed images, videos, and other media.
- Conditional logic and calculations.
- Redirect upon completion.
Pricing Model: Tally operates on a freemium model. The free plan includes unlimited forms and responses, with advanced features like custom branding and CSS available on the Pro plan, which starts at $29 per month. (tally.so)
Pros:
- Generous free tier with no per-form limits.
- Intuitive, Notion-like editor.
- Advanced features at a competitive price point.
Cons:
- Limited direct integrations with platforms like Shopify.
- Advanced features may require a learning curve.
Best-Fit Customer Profile: Ideal for startups, creators, and small teams seeking a cost-effective and straightforward form builder without the need for extensive integrations.
Typeform
Typeform is renowned for its conversational form and survey builder, emphasizing user engagement through a beautiful user experience. It allows for the creation of interactive, one-question-at-a-time forms that can enhance completion rates.
Features:
- Engaging, conversational forms with one question at a time.
- Extensive template library.
- Advanced logic and branching.
- Customizable design elements.
- Analytics and reporting tools.
Pricing Model: Typeform offers a free plan with limited responses per month. Paid plans, which provide additional features and higher response limits, start at $39 per month. (zigpoll.com)
Pros:
- High-quality, engaging form designs.
- Comprehensive analytics and reporting.
- Robust integrations with various platforms.
Cons:
- Higher pricing compared to some competitors.
- Free plan has limited responses and features.
Best-Fit Customer Profile: Suitable for enterprises and premium brands that prioritize user engagement and require advanced analytics and integrations.
Fillout
Fillout is a modern form builder that offers native integrations with Airtable and Notion, allowing for seamless data management. It provides a user-friendly interface for creating forms, surveys, and quizzes.
Features:
- Native integrations with Airtable and Notion.
- Unlimited forms and responses on the free plan.
- Multi-page forms and conditional logic.
- Customizable design elements.
- Embed images, videos, and other media.
Pricing Model: Fillout operates on a freemium model. The free plan includes unlimited forms and responses, with advanced features like custom branding and additional integrations available on paid plans starting at $15 per month. (fillout.com)
Pros:
- Generous free tier with unlimited forms and responses.
- Deep integrations with Airtable and Notion.
- User-friendly interface.
Cons:
- Limited direct integrations with Shopify.
- Advanced features may require a paid plan.
Best-Fit Customer Profile: Ideal for teams already using Airtable or Notion who need a form builder that integrates seamlessly with these platforms.
